Social networks surprise again with a new viral video that has made thousands of users laugh on TikTok.

The protagonist of this story is Tato Capobianco, a user of the platform, who has shared a fun moment starring his dog, leaving everyone with a smile on his face.

In the viral TikTok video, Tato Capobianco humorously narrates an anecdote that happened to him with his furry four-legged friend. As he explains, in a funny tone, his dog stayed in the garden enjoying the sun, and when he realized it, he found a scene worthy of a comedy: the dog was motionless, "frozen" under the rays of the sun. sun.

The video shows the dog in question, lying motionless in a study-worthy position, which seems to suggest that it is completely "frozen" while basking in the sun. The humorous description of Tato Capobianco and the image of the dog in this unusual position have led to the video going viral with more than 300,000 views and more than 300 comments on TikTok.

The reaction of the community was not long in coming. The comments were filled with laughter and expressions of amazement at the funny scene: "The nap that we all want to take," says a user. "It broke," says another jokingly. "It has been bugged, you have to restart it," expresses another jokingly to solve that problem.

Tato Capobianco's ability to tell this anecdote in a humorous way, the description of the video with the phrase "Does anyone know if he's alive??", and the way he captured his dog's situation have been key to the video becoming in a real hit on TikTok.
